The PIC18LF1220-I/SS is a microcontroller (MCU) from Microchip Technology's PIC18F series. It is a member of the 8-bit PIC18 family of flash microcontrollers that are designed for general-purpose and embedded control applications.
Description:
The PIC18LF1220-I/SS is a mid-range flash microcontroller featuring a 16-bit instruction set and a wide range of integrated peripherals. It is available in a 28-pin surface-mount small-outline (SO) package. The device is designed to provide high performance and low power consumption, making it suitable for a variety of applications.
Features:
- Enhanced Core: The PIC18LF1220-I/SS features an enhanced mid-range core with a 16-bit instruction set, providing faster execution and reduced program memory requirements.
- Memory: The device offers 128KB of flash program memory, 4KB of RAM, and 256 bytes of EEPROM for non-volatile data storage.
- Peripherals: The PIC18LF1220-I/SS includes a variety of integrated peripherals, such as a Universal Synchronous/Asynchronous Receiver/Transmitter (USART), a Serial Peripheral Interface (SPI), an Inter-Integrated Circuit (I2C) interface, and a Parallel Master Port (PMP) for easy connectivity.
- Timers: The device features three 8-bit timers and one 16-bit timer, providing flexible timing and event handling capabilities.
- ADC: The PIC18LF1220-I/SS includes a 10-bit Analog-to-Digital Converter (ADC) with up to 8 channels, allowing for accurate analog signal processing.
- PWM: The device offers up to 5 Programmable Pulse Width Modulation (PWM) outputs for controlling motor speeds, dimming LEDs, and generating waveforms.
- Low Power: The PIC18LF1220-I/SS supports various low-power modes, enabling extended battery life in portable applications.
- Security: The device features a variety of security options, including a tamper detection circuit, password protection, and a unique ID for device authentication.
Applications:
The PIC18LF1220-I/SS is suitable for a wide range of applications, including but not limited to:
- Industrial control systems: The device's robust set of peripherals and timers make it ideal for controlling motors, managing sensors, and implementing complex control algorithms.
- Consumer electronics: The PIC18LF1220-I/SS can be used in appliances, such as washing machines, refrigerators, and air conditioners, for monitoring and controlling various parameters.
- Automotive systems: The device's low power consumption and integrated peripherals make it suitable for automotive applications, such as engine control, infotainment systems, and body electronics.
- Medical devices: The PIC18LF1220-I/SS can be used in medical equipment, such as blood glucose meters, portable defibrillators, and patient monitoring systems, for accurate data processing and control.
- Communication systems: The integrated USART, SPI, and I2C interfaces make the device suitable for implementing communication protocols in various applications, such as home automation, security systems, and data acquisition systems.
In summary, the PIC18LF1220-I/SS is a versatile and powerful microcontroller that offers a wide range of features and capabilities, making it suitable for a variety of embedded control applications across different industries.